Soap is made by combining fats and sodium hydroxide (lye) with each other.
Southern Natural Llc Can Be Fun For Everyone
The scientific word for this reaction is saponification. Fats are fats, butters and oils such as coconut oil, olive oil, or rapeseed oil, to call only a few. These oils make up the base of natural soap bars. By picking to make use of natural oils over animal fats, soap manufacturers can conveniently make their soap vegetarian.
It is vital to keep in mind that lye must always be poured right into the water, as pouring water onto lye produces an unsafe chain reaction called a 'lye volcano'. The next action is to weigh out any kind of base oils or butters; these are your fatty acids. Oils that are solid at space temperature level need to be carefully melted before combining with the already fluid ones.
This part of the soap making procedure is known as getting to trace. In the hot process technique, it will certainly take longer for the batter to get to trace because the mixture requires to prepare and enlarge much longer in order to finish the saponification procedure. Once the batter has actually reached trace, any vital oils, colourants, or ingredients need to be mixed into the mix.

As soon as completely incorporated, the batter prepares to be poured into moulds and left to cool down in a refuge. This is the part where we love to get a little imaginative and leading our soap loaves with lovely, organic ingredients to ensure that they look wonderful in your shower room. Yet do not be deceived! Covering soap with a little touch of finery doesn't just make them quite.
In the cool soap making process, soap batter needs to be left for 24 hours to saponify when it can be removed from the moulds and sliced right into bars. These will certainly need to be delegated heal for 6-8 weeks prior to they are risk-free for use. In the warm soap making procedure, the batter needs to be scooped into moulds and left overnight to cool.
Since the soap bars have actually finished curing, they can be eliminated from their moulds and made use of to keep your body, face and hands fresh and clean. Soap making can be a harmful procedure as a result of the usage of lye, as a result it is vital to make certain that you have watched the ideal security videos and are completely clued up before attempting this at home.
